Whereabouts in the state are you visiting/staying? Hampton beach is ok, but it's kinda lame nowadays. If you are going to check out the seacoast, Portsmouth or Rye are nicer areas. Inland, the white mountains and the White Mountain National Forest offer a ton of things to do, and yes, there is a tram. The lakes region is also nice this time of year, and there's lots of things to do on Lake Winnipesaukee (sp?).
